    update from my previous profile

    Ride: Toyota Innova G
    Year: 2008
    Displacement: 2.5L M/T
    Engine Configuration: D4D
    Fuel Consumption:
    -City: estimated: 10 to 11 Km per liter
    -Highway: estimated 14 to 15 Km per liter
    -Mixed: measured: 12 to 13 Km per liter

    i have a 97' camry 2.2L A/T. parehas lang consumo niya compared to an Optra 1.6 A/T. hehe. anyway its a really nice car, the suspension is soft and comfortable, in fact even better than my dad's newer model Camry. Fuel consumption gets around 8km/L but thats with moderate tipid driving but with A/C always on. maganda talga itong car na ito. but all other 2.0L cars in its category has the same consumption. my friends 98' cefiro does around 7km/L, and accord 2.2L VTEC does about the same. Classy yung car na ito, but makes you look like a daddy lang nga.
